1. Monoprice Mini Delta V2: Efficiency Meets Simplicity

The Monoprice Mini Delta V2 is an excellent choice for beginners due to its compact size and user-friendly features. This printer utilizes a delta design, which allows for faster printing speeds and higher accuracy. With an impressive build height of 12 inches and a 4-inch diameter, it's perfect for creating small prototypes or detailed models.

One of the standout features of the Mini Delta V2 is its ease of assembly. It comes partially assembled, enabling kids and parents to set it up quickly and get started with printing in no time. The printer also supports various filament types, including PLA, which is safe and easy to work with for young users. Furthermore, it features a built-in LCD screen for easy navigation, making it accessible for kids to learn the basics of 3D printing.

2. Creality Ender 3 V2: A Gateway to Advanced Printing

The Creality Ender 3 V2 is a fantastic option for kids who are ready to dive deeper into 3D printing. Known for its robust design, this printer offers an exceptional build volume of 220 x 220 x 250 mm, making it suitable for larger projects. The Ender 3 V2 also features a glass bed, which helps models adhere better during printing and makes for easier removal.

What sets this printer apart is its online community and plethora of upgrade options. Children and parents can explore modifications and enhancements, helping young makers learn about improving technology. The Ender 3 V2's open-source nature encourages experimentation, fostering a sense of curiosity and innovation, as kids can customize and adapt their machines.

3. FlashForge Adventurer 3: Smart and Intuitive

The FlashForge Adventurer 3 is designed for simplicity without sacrificing functionality. This model is well-known for its enclosed build chamber, which not only maintains a stable temperature but also ensures safety for younger users. With a build volume of 150 x 150 x 150 mm, it’s ideal for small projects and beginner-friendly prints. Related reading: online art resources.

Parents will appreciate the printer's intuitive touchscreen interface, which makes it easy for kids to operate. Moreover, the Adventurer 3 offers a hassle-free filament loading system, allowing children to focus on creativity rather than technical difficulties. Its Wi-Fi connectivity enables remote printing and monitoring, making it a great choice for tech-savvy families.

4. Anycubic Photon Mono: Unleash Artistic Potential

If your child is interested in detailed miniature models or intricate designs, the Anycubic Photon Mono is a fantastic option. This resin printer utilizes UV light to create highly detailed parts with a resolution of 50 microns, allowing for stunning prints that are difficult to achieve with standard FDM printers. (See: 3D printing in education.)

While working with resin requires more precautions due to safety concerns, the Photon Mono's user-friendly interface and straightforward setup make it accessible for older kids. The printer is compact, making it easy to fit into a home workspace, and its fast printing speeds mean young creators won’t have to wait long to see their designs come to life.

6. Prusa Mini: The Perfect Blend of Performance and Affordability

For families looking for a reliable, high-quality 3D printer, the Prusa Mini is an excellent contender. Known for its great print quality, this printer offers a build volume of 180 x 180 x 180 mm, making it versatile for various projects. Its open-source nature encourages kids to experiment, learn, and even troubleshoot as they go.

The Prusa Mini is also equipped with an easy-to-use interface and a robust online support system, making it perfect for both beginners and those ready to expand their 3D printing skills. Its vibrant online community provides access to a wealth of resources, including tutorials and tips to help young creators succeed.

Considerations When Choosing 3D Printers for Kids

When selecting a 3D printer for children, several factors should be taken into account. Safety is paramount, so look for models that have enclosed designs, are easy to operate, and utilize non-toxic materials. Additionally, consider the age and experience level of the child. Some printers require a greater understanding of technology, while others are designed specifically for beginners.

Another important aspect is the size and build volume of the printer. Depending on the types of projects your child wishes to create, different printers will serve various needs. Lastly, community support and available resources can enhance the learning experience, as kids can seek help and discover new ideas from fellow enthusiasts. Frequently Asked Questions About 3D Printers for Kids

What is the best age for children to start using a 3D printer?

Most children can begin using 3D printers around the ages of 8 to 10, with supervision. As they grow older, they can gradually take on more complex projects and responsibilities.

Are 3D printers safe for children?

Yes, many 3D printers are designed with safety features that make them suitable for children. Look for models with enclosed designs and non-toxic filament options.

Do I need to provide any additional materials?

Yes, in addition to the printer, you will usually need to purchase filament or resin separately. Some printers come with starter materials, but it's important to check beforehand. This builds on top play picks for kids.

Can kids design their own creations?

Absolutely! Many 3D printers come with user-friendly software that allows kids to create their own designs. There are also online platforms and resources that provide templates for beginners.

What are the common challenges kids face with 3D printing?
